Albert Talley ,92, died at 5 p.m. Thursday at the home of his son, Perry Talley of Ottumwa. He was born January 20,1852 near Ioka, the son of George Cypert and Angeline Edwards Talley. He spent his entire life in Richland and Keokuk Counties with the exception of the last 3 years when he made his home with his son, He was preceded in death by
his wife, Caroline, March 10,1940, and by one son
in 1927.
He is survived besides his son in Ottumwa, by another son Russell Talley of Richland; 4 daughters, . Anna Smithhart of Keota, Mrs. Jessie Lewman and Mrs. Mattie Lake of Richland, and Mrs.Pearl Hubbs of Washington.31 grandchildren and 33 great grandchildren.
Funeral services will be held at 2 p.m Saturday at the Community cente.Funeral home in charge of the Rev. Dawson, pastor of the Friends Church in Richland. Burial will be made at the Blue Point Cemetery. The body will remain at the funeral parlors until time For service. His grandchildren
will act as pallbearers.
